SCI – Afghanistan:

Save the Children has been making a positive impact in Afghanistan since 1976, closely adhering to the UN Convention on the Rights of the Child. Our programs focus on providing better education, enabling more children to attend school, and promoting basic health to save lives.

Role Purpose:

The Procurement Officer (Sourcing) is responsible for ensuring procurement policies and procedures are adhered to in a timely manner, in compliance with donor rules. This role includes receiving procurement requests, overseeing sourcing activities, and maintaining high standards while supporting the Senior Supply Chain Officer in program activities.

Scope of Role:

Reports to: Procurement Coordinator

Staff reporting to this post: NA

Close working relationships: Finance, HR, Programme Operations, Supply Chain

Key Areas of Accountability:

Sourcing:

Receive and/or be assigned new procurement requests, ensuring compliance with procurement policies.

Facilitate procurement committee meetings, leading the development of Competitive Bid Analysis and meeting minutes.

Review all documents before final pre-payment checks by the Procurement Coordinator.

Tracking:

Update the procurement tracker daily and share it with provincial staff on a weekly basis.

Asset Management:

Log all SCI program assets on the program asset register and issue unique SCI Asset ID numbers.

Maintain a tracking system for all equipment issued to staff, ensuring proper training in equipment use and care.

Miscellaneous:

  • Promote the inclusion and empowerment of female staff within the workplace.
  • Maintain a well-organized filing and documentation system for all procurement processes.
  • Scan all procurement and payment documents, recording soft copies appropriately.
  • Perform any other tasks assigned by the supervisor.
